Market Research Society of New Zealand (MRSNZ) Definition

The professional body for market researchers. Closely affiliated with the Association of Market Research Organizations (AMRO) which is the industry body representing the major research organizations.

The Market Research Society of New Zealand (MRSNZ) was a professional organization that promoted best practices, ethical standards and advancements in the market research industry in New Zealand. In 2013, it merged with the Association of Market Research Organisations to form the Research Association New Zealand (RANZ), which continues its mission to support the research profession.

What are key aspects of the Market Research Society of New Zealand (MRSNZ)? 

Key aspects of MRSNZ (now RANZ) include:

  • Professional standards: Establishes guidelines for ethical and quality research practices.
  • Certification and accreditation: Offers recognized certifications for research professionals.
  • Training and resources: Provides courses, seminars and publications for skill development.
  • Networking opportunities: Connects members through industry events and forums.
  • Advocacy: Represents the research industry’s interests to policymakers and the public.
